a) Immersion Thermostat
− Hang the thermostat into the bath to be thermostated
(baths
Section 10. Accessories)
− In baths made of plastic the heater should
not have contact to the sides of the bath!
− Do not cover the ventilation opening at the
back of the unit.
Keep clear distance of at least 20 cm.
Adjustment of the pump chamber
− The fixation of the temperature probe has
to be moved upwards approx. 15 mm.
− Adjust the pump chamber.
− Move the fixation of the temperature probe
downwards again (see ill. on the left)
− For all LAUDA baths (plastic and deep-drawn baths),
please fix the adapter (standard accessory) on the
clamping bracket.
− Turn the jet nozzle to face diagonally into the bath. The
outflow for the bath circulation can then be closed.
− Turn the setting knob to the left (see. ill. 1.)
